Many questions have been raised following the spectacular implosion of cryptocurrency exchange FTX, once the most loved and raved about. A key issue that has come up is why Singapore retail users and their assets are not parked under the Singapore entity, Quoine Pte Ltd, which has received an exemption from the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S).
